After wrapping up the crucial US schedule, the unit of Mahesh Babu’s landmark silver jubilee film, Maharshi, are currently shooting several crucial scenes on Mahesh, Prakash Raj and Jayasudha in Hyderabad. The latest schedule will be completed by November 17.
And later, the team will wrap up a major portion of the film’s shoot in a month-long schedule in a specially erected village set in Hyderabad. In Maharshi, Mahesh plays a US-based businessman who comes to a village in one of the twin Telugu states on a mission.
Pooja Hegde is the leading lady in Maharshi and Allari Naresh essays a key role in the film. Vamshi Paidipally is directing the film and Dil Raju, Ashwini Dutt and PVP are jointly producing this much-awaited project. DSP is the film’s music composer. Maharshi is slated to hit theaters on April 5.
